How would you like to travel back 1000 years on board your time machine through the backyards and houses to the bustling streets of Jorvik? Well guess what? You can do just that at the "JORVIK Viking Centre" at Coppergate in York, with their audio and video displays which will help you to investigate all of the information gathered from the 5-year long archaeological dig, giving you the experience of life in Viking-Age York.

At the JORVIK Viking Centre you will be standing on the site of one of the most famous and amazing discoveries of modern archaeology in the UK. The dig took place between the years 1976 - 1981 archaeologists from "York Archaeological Trust" revealed the dwellings, workshops and backyards of the 1000 year old Viking-Age city of Jorvik.
